Quote:
Originally Posted by inspector8
I am not happy with my Wineguard Carryout. I have to run it directly to receiver to make it work while my manual sattelite dish worked fine using coach wiring from rear compartment. Does anyone else have this problem? Is the signal stronger from my old bigger manual aiming dish than the smaller carryout?
|
Check the quick start guide for the Carryout, page 4. If you have a setup similar to what's shown, then it may have a problem getting a signal through. Some coaches use a single feed coax for cable and satellite.
http://www.winegard.com/kbase/upload...StartGuide.pdf
My Itasca has separate cable and exterior satellite coax feeds and I have had no problem using the Carryout on DirecTV last year and now on Dish. It would not receive HD on DirecTV, but does on Dish. Also, it automatically switches between satellites on Dish, which a manual system will not unless it's a multi LNB.

Quote:
Originally Posted by inspector8
My rear connection in rear compartment says cable not sattelite. Is that the problem? This connection worked fine fro manual pointing duel LMB dish sattelite but not for Wineguard Carryout
|
The old cable line can't carry the 12v signal needed for the Wineguard Carryout. I had to run a different cable.

The reason you are having power issues running through your rig is the co-ax is probably RG 59. You need RG6 to supply enough voltage from the receiver back to the portable sat dish.
